EVENT OVERVIEW
Overview
Since 1983, the 3,200-member Independent Book Publishers Association
(formerly PMA) has centered on educating both emerging and experienced publishers. For twenty-seven years IBPA’s Publishing University has been the association’s
flagship event for bringing publishing education to the industry and features:
• Multiple educational sessions presented by industry
experts over a two-day period.
• The 2011 IBPA Publishing University will take advantage of the synergy provided by all the publishing-related events taking place at the Jacob K. Javits Convention Center.
• A day and a half of education culminating with the
23rd annual celebration of Benjamin Franklin Award winners.
• Numerous networking opportunities, including an exhibit hall, daily
continental breakfast, nightly reception, keynote speaker and luncheon.
• Attendance that has averaged 300 over the past 5 years.
Membership Luncheon Keynote Address
Skip Prichard will deliver the Membership Luncheon keynote address on Monday, May 23rd. Mr. Prichard’s perspective as the leader of Ingram Content Group, which sits at a crucial intersection between publishers, retailers, and libraries, offers a unique view of the future of books and publishing and the already proven business models that are helping publishers connect content to opportunity.
The 23rd Annual IBPA Benjamin Franklin Awards™
The Benjamin Franklin Award presentation and reception, historically drawing more than 400+ attendees, is scheduled for Monday night, May 23rd. The award has recognized excellence in publishing for more than 20 years. Previous winners include publishers both large and small—from Sourcebooks, John Wiley & Sons and Smithsonian Books, to Carl Sams, Momentum Books and Hip Pocket Press!
